Vijay G Badllani turns 'Parashuram' for the poetic play, Rashmi Rathi

Vijay G Badllani

Vijay G Badllani, our very own ‘Naaradji’ of SAB TV’s Yam Hai Hum is ‘ecstatic’ and looks forward to perform to a packed crowd for his poetic play, Rashmi Rathi, written by Ramdhari Singh Dinkar.

The poetic play in pure Sanskrit will narrate the story of Karna through the epic battle and beyond.
 
Vijay will play the role of Parashuram, Guru to Karna who would have taught him martial arts of that era.
 
When contacted, Vijay told us, “Yes, the energy level is high as we are all set to stage our show in various cities. The USP of the play will be that it will be in poetic form with all the emotions intact. I have a fight sequence with Karna, wherein Parashuram will be shown imparting martial art skills to Karna.”

Talking about the shows they will have in the coming week, Vijay said, “We will be staging it in Sathy College, Mumbai on 17 September. We then have it in Delhi on 20 September, followed by shows in Banaras on 24th and Patna on 26th.”
